Output 75b4198e306787e73b75fac443a47de76bb68edd3194b913d0afcc866156b959:4

value
70808186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da120ebf3f9cf8333cc3142631d8c0fbd513d647 OP_EQUAL
address
MTnDAuwopd3hJ9k3cZW41Jk9uU8QHLZEuL
transaction
75b4198e306787e73b75fac443a47de76bb68edd3194b913d0afcc866156b959
spent
true